    Key Shrimp Species Farmed in Mozambique

    When we talk about shrimp aquaculture in Mozambique, it's essential to know which species are most commonly farmed. The Penaeus vannamei, also known as the whiteleg shrimp, is a popular choice due to its rapid growth, disease resistance, and adaptability to various farming conditions. This species is native to the Eastern Pacific coast of Latin America but has been successfully introduced to aquaculture farms worldwide, including Mozambique. Another species of interest is the Penaeus monodon, or black tiger shrimp, which is native to the Indo-Pacific region. While it's more challenging to farm than the Penaeus vannamei, it commands a higher market price due to its larger size and distinct flavor.

    Besides these two main species, there is also interest in farming indigenous shrimp species that are well-adapted to the local environment. This approach can help reduce the risk of introducing exotic diseases and minimize the impact on native ecosystems. Research is ongoing to identify and develop suitable indigenous species for aquaculture in Mozambique.     Farming Practices and Technologies

    Let's get into the nitty-gritty of shrimp aquaculture in Mozambique! Shrimp farming typically involves several stages, starting with hatchery production of juvenile shrimp (post-larvae). These post-larvae are then transferred to nursery ponds where they grow to a larger size before being moved to grow-out ponds. Grow-out ponds are where the shrimp reach their marketable size.

    Various farming systems are used, ranging from extensive to intensive. Extensive systems rely on natural food sources and have low stocking densities, while intensive systems use formulated feeds and high stocking densities. Intensive systems generally yield higher production but require more investment and careful management to maintain water quality and prevent disease outbreaks. Recirculating aquaculture systems (RAS) are also gaining popularity due to their ability to minimize water usage and environmental impact. These systems recycle water through a series of filters and treatment processes, allowing for more controlled and sustainable production.     Challenges and Opportunities

    Of course, shrimp aquaculture in Mozambique isn't without its challenges. Disease outbreaks, such as white spot syndrome virus (WSSV), can decimate entire shrimp populations, causing significant economic losses. Other challenges include access to financing, the high cost of feed, and the need for skilled labor. Climate change also poses a threat, with rising sea levels and changing weather patterns potentially impacting coastal aquaculture operations.

    Sustainability and Environmental Considerations

    When we talk about shrimp aquaculture in Mozambique, sustainability is key. It's essential to minimize the environmental impact of shrimp farming by adopting responsible practices. This includes proper wastewater treatment to prevent pollution of coastal ecosystems, responsible sourcing of feed ingredients to avoid deforestation and overfishing, and the implementation of biosecurity measures to prevent the spread of diseases. Integrated multi-trophic aquaculture (IMTA) is another promising approach that involves farming shrimp alongside other species, such as seaweed and shellfish, to create a more balanced and sustainable ecosystem.
